When I put on left turn signal it blinks super fast and it means my brake light is out. It is burning up the bulbs. Four metal connection on bulb itself. Melting the plastic around one of the metal connectors. I think I need to replace the harness. A short or something is melting the plastic part of bulb. What do you think?

If it got hot enough to melt it is possible that the contacts are touching inside the plastic. You can buy replacement bulb socket pigtails at most auto parts stores. You would cut the bad one off of the harness then connect the new one in its place.
You just need the color codes to match the wires to the socket.
For yours they are
Black = Ground
Brown = Marker/Running/Tail light feed for all corners.

Light Blue = Front Left Turn lamp
Dark Blue = Front Right Turn lamp

Yellow = Left Rear Stop/Turn lamp
Dark Green = Right Rear Stop/Turn lamp
